Tin Bitz is a kind of dirty metallic, slightly more 'brown' or maybe dark bronzy than boltgun, but about the same level of darkness. It used to be a GW paint, but that was from the pop-cap era. I still have a pot that works. Have to make some experiments, if I ever gets my minis.
I searched for an equivalent. Lot of painters use GW Warplock Bronce for it.

Well after saying that the minis need around 25 Mins each I really went to town and finished 8 more this week. So two 5 Alien stalker "squads"  are finished.


I primed it with FoW British Armour (Desert), after that just a hint of white primer on top. 
Then a Citadel Reikland Fleshshade and some Agrax Earthshade here and there.
After drying a very light drybrush in white, then Enamel glossy clear.


The black Aliens are even simpler, black primer, boltgun brushwork, nuln oil wash, very light drybrush in silver, glossy varnish.

The Alien I “Infant” is painted. Also the first Colonial Marine.



The 5 “Infants” received the same simple paint treatment as the black Stalkers above. So again black primer, boltgun brushwork, nuln oil wash, very light drybrush in silver. Only difference, before the glossy varnish I gave the minis a thinned layer of Citadels Guilliman Blue Glaze.


The Marine took longer to paint. The mini is again a wonderful sculpt, very realistic proportioned and full of detail.
